As a homeowner with trees on your property, you will want to make sure that you are well aware of when a tree might need to be removed. This way, you will be more likely to know when to call for tree removal service before you end up dealing with some serious problems. Here are a few of the signs that indicate that there is a need for you to have a tree removed:
The Tree Is Too Close To Your House
If you have a tree that is growing too close to your house, you will want to consider having it removed. This is especially important if the branches of that tree are touching the roof of your home. Even if they are not exactly touching just yet, if they do touch when the wind blows during a heavy storm, that is enough of a problem. Those branches could rip shingles off of the roof of your home. Large branches could fall from the tree and crash right through your roof.
The Tree Is Causing A Problem With The Neighbors
When you have a tree too close to the property line, there will be a section of the branches that will hang over the neighboring property. Some people are not bothered by this. In fact, they might love their neighbor's tree because of the shade it gives in their yard during certain times of the day. However, other people might be annoyed by dropping tree branches and leaves that fall during the autumn. If your neighbor is always complaining about your tree and you always have to clean up after it, you might want to consider simply removing it. You can always plant another tree a little further back into your property so when it grows, it will not interfere with any neighboring properties.
The Tree Is Not Healthy
If you have a tree on your property that is looking rather sickly, you will want to make an appointment to have it professionally removed before it falls down on its own. After all, when a tree is left to die, it will eventually fall, and there is no way to know if it will land on your home, on the neighbor's car, or in an area where it will not hurt anything. This is why it is better to have it removed professionally before any of that can happen.
